/* eslint-disable no-console */
import { stdin, stdout } from "process";
// eslint-disable-next-line import/no-extraneous-dependencies
import { JSONParser } from "@streamparser/json-whatwg";
import { ILocalContext, IRemoteContext, Registry } from "../index";
class Local {
#counter = 0;
constructor() {
this.Increment = this.Increment.bind(this);
}
async Increment(ctx: ILocalContext, delta: number): Promise<number> {
console.log(
"Incrementing counter by",
delta,
"for remote with ID",
ctx.remoteID
);
this.#counter += delta;
return this.#counter;
}
}
class Remote {
// eslint-disable-next-line class-methods-use-this, @typescript-eslint/no-unused-vars, @typescript-eslint/no-empty-function
async Println(ctx: IRemoteContext, msg: string) {}
}
let clients = 0;
const registry = new Registry(
new Local(),
new Remote(),
{
onClientConnect: () => {
clients++;
console.error(clients, "clients connected");
},
onClientDisconnect: () => {
clients--;
console.error(clients, "clients connected");
},
}
);
console.error(`Run one of the following commands to run a function on the remote(s):
- kill -SIGHUP ${process.pid}: Increment remote counter by one`);
process.on("SIGHUP", async () => {
await registry.forRemotes(async (remoteID, remote) => {
console.error("Calling functions for remote with ID", remoteID);
try {
await remote.Println(undefined, "Hello, world!");
} catch (e) {
console.error(`Got error for Increment func: ${e}`);
}
});
});
const linkSignal = new AbortController();
const encoder = new WritableStream({
write(chunk) {
return new Promise<void>((res) => {
const isDrained = stdout.write(JSON.stringify(chunk));
if (!isDrained) {
stdout.once("drain", res);
} else {
res();
}
});
},
close() {
return new Promise((res) => {
stdout.end(res);
});
},
abort(reason) {
stdout.destroy(reason instanceof Error ? reason : new Error(reason));
},
});
const parser = new JSONParser({
paths: ["$"],
separator: "",
});
const parserWriter = parser.writable.getWriter();
const parserReader = parser.readable.getReader();
const decoder = new ReadableStream({
start(controller) {
parserReader
.read()
.then(async function process({ done, value }) {
if (done) {
controller.close();
return;
}
controller.enqueue(value?.value);
parserReader
.read()
.then(process)
.catch((e) => controller.error(e));
})
.catch((e) => controller.error(e));
},
});
stdin.on("data", (m) => parserWriter.write(m));
stdin.on("close", () => {
parserReader.cancel();
parserWriter.abort();
linkSignal.abort();
});
registry.linkStream(
linkSignal.signal,
encoder,
decoder,
(v) => v,
(v) => v
);
console.error("Connected to stdin and stdout");
